ref(eap-outcomes): updating committing logic, more metrics (#7813)
## Summary This PR improves the committing and backpressure handling in the accepted outcomes consumer, and adds a `--commit-frequency-sec` parameter to control how often commit requests are emitted. ### Changes - **`CommitOutcomes`**: Added a configurable `commit_frequency` (default 10s) so that offsets are only committed on a timer rather than on every poll. Offsets are now only tracked after a successful produce — if the produce step rejects a message, offsets are **not** advanced. On `join`, a forced commit is issued regardless of the timer. - **`OutcomesAggregator`**: Fixed backpressure handling. Previously, when the next step rejected a message during flush, the batch was silently restored and the flush effectively became a no-op. Now, a rejected message is carried over and retried on the next `poll`. While a message is carried over, incoming `submit` calls return `MessageRejected` so upstream applies backpressure. The `join` path also retries carried-over messages until they succeed or the deadline elapses. - **`ProduceOutcome`**: Added a `timer!` metric (`accepted_outcomes.batch_produce_ms`) to track how long each batch produce takes. - **`accepted_outcomes_consumer` CLI**: Added `--commit-frequency-sec` (default `10`) that is plumbed through to `CommitOutcomes`. ### Future considerations - Might have this just run `RunTask` instead of `RunTaskInThreads` given that producing should be pretty quick and batching will be what takes longer, might be better to prevent flushing a batch until the first once is done producing. If we have multiple threads and something fails that would be more data loss if we are committing early --------- Co-authored-by: Claude Sonnet 4.6 <noreply@anthropic.com>
